## 2.4.0 — Changed defaults

The Garaview occupancy feed now polls lot sensors every 30s instead of 10s. The old default hammered the Kestrel Parking gateway during peak hours and tripped rate limits. Stale-read tolerance raised to 90s accordingly. No migration needed; restart pollers after deploy. Current production settings for the feed service are listed below.

deployment values, kajog-kajep:
[briwyn]
team = holix
access_code = ac_8d066e
owner = gilix.quenion
host = briwyn.zemvardyn.internal
port = 4000
peer = juldor.ferralabs.internal
salt = 1f7475b6
pin = 1838

Audience: heads of department. Restricted page.

Current state: Brellick Industries accounts for 41% of recurring revenue on the Moravale platform. Contract renews in ten months. Loss scenario would force immediate cost action across three departments.

Mitigations underway: broaden mid-market pipeline, cap further Brellick customisation work, and diversify the Ostley services line. Do not discuss figures outside this group. The board's agreed response direction is recorded in the confidential note below.

board note of bawep-tajef: Queniusek Systems plans to raise the Quenvan list price by 53.1 percent in March. The pricing group signed off on a budget of $176.4 million for Project Drueth. The renewal with Casionix Partners closes at $142.5 million a year, 8.3 percent below the last contract. Project Fraax slips by six weeks because of the tooling delay.

## Provenance: Brancheon Cleanup Bot

Brancheon, the stale-branch cleanup bot, runs from a single attested image built nightly by the Kellward pipeline. If the bot misbehaves on call, first confirm the running image matches the attested build; drift here has previously caused branches to be deleted out of policy. Compare the deployed digest against the registry before escalating to the platform team. The trace token for tonight's verified image follows.

pipeline stamp: htk31_f769b577b3028a4e9958e5bb8d1259a